Problem

Straddle-type vehicles, such as motorcycles, face difficulties in cornering during cruise control due to inadequate control of acceleration/deceleration, which affects the vehicle's posture and makes appropriate cornering challenging.

Innovation Solution

A controller that restricts vehicle speed to an upper limit during turns, detects the exit of a curved road based on a predicted route, and reduces deceleration before reaching the exit, allowing for appropriate cornering by controlling acceleration/deceleration without driver input.

The present invention obtains a controller and a control method capable of achieving appropriate cornering during cruise control of a straddle-type vehicle.In the controller and the control method according to the present invention, during the cruise control, in which acceleration/deceleration of the straddle-type vehicle is automatically controlled without relying on an accelerating/decelerating operation by a driver, a vehicle speed of the straddle-type vehicle is restricted to be equal to or lower than an upper limit speed at the time of turning, an exit of a curved road is detected on the basis of a predicted route of the straddle-type vehicle, and a magnitude of the deceleration of the decelerated straddle-type vehicle is reduced at a time point before the straddle-type vehicle reaches the exit.
